The Philippines Partnership for Sustainable Agriculture (PPSA) is a multi-stakeholder partnership platform initiated by Grow Asia, a regional platform for inclusive and sustainable agriculture development in Southeast Asia catalyzed by the World Economic Forum and the ASEAN Secretariat. Grow Asia’s goal is to reach smallholder farmers in ASEAN through its Country Chapters like the PPSA to build regional and country partnerships and broker market-driven solutions for more inclusive, resilient, and sustainable food systems in Southeast Asia.

 

PPSA was formally launched by Grow Asia together with the Philippine Department of Agriculture and through the collective efforts of various stakeholders. PPSA, with the Department of Agriculture and EastWest Seed as its Co-Chairs, has brought together more than 120 organizations, reaching more than 120,000 smallholders through commodity Working Groups (WGs) focused on Coconut, Coffee, Corn, Vegetables, Rice, and Fisheries as well as cross-cutting or thematic working groups on Agri-financing, Digital Agriculture, and the Learning Alliance. Its aim is to harness the collective strength of  agricultural value chain players towards transforming food systems to become climate positive and inclusive through market-driven solutions.

​

Since its beginnings in 2015, PPSA has been driving partnerships that work on value chain studies, knowledge sharing, and market linkage. The latter being the most identified value it brings not only to the core members, but to an extended network of market players, from multinational companies, cooperatives, farmer associations, groups, and individual farmers. How did we start?

PPSA was formally launched in 2015 by Grow Asia and the Department of Agriculture in partnership with local and global companies. In 2017, Grow Asia launched its collaboration with the Philippine Business for Social Progress (PBSP), a business-led social development organization committed to poverty reduction. In June 2020, Grow Asia established PPSA as a legal entity. 

 

The collaboration established the PPSA Secretariat which serves as an in-country coordinating body. It has been providing on-the-ground support to Working Groups in the areas of performance measurement, resource mobilization, research and technical assistance as well as communications.
